Mary Rachel Pitzer, 81, of Princeton died suddenly February 23, 2025 at Roanoke Memorial Hospital. Born October 20, 1943, she was the daughter of the late James Thornhill and Gladys Thornhill. Mary loved to Read her bible, crafts and Spring and Fall seasons. She was a dedicated member of Rogers Street Community Church serving the lord and taking in the messages of Pastors Gene Pennington and Steve Pendleton. In addition to her Parents, she is preceded in death by her husband’s Bobby Smith and James Pitzer. Son Teddy Smith, Siblings Buck Thornhill, Mamie Rice, Barbara Thomas and Betty Poole. She is survived by her children Regina Weeks (Bo Allen) of Oakvale, Karen Smith of Tennessee, Melissa Riddle of North Carolina, Freddy Smith of Virginia, Crystal Toombes (Doug) of Tennessee and Debbie Barlow (Aaron) of Lshmeet. Special Grandchildren Loveitta, Shane, and Levi as well as numerous other grandchildren and great-grandchildren, Siblings Mike Thornhill (Karen) of Princeton and Vickie Young (Melvin) of Princeton. Honoring Mary’s wishes, she will be cremated and no service to be held. Online Condolences may be shared with the family via www.fredekingfs.com. Arrangements by Fredeking Funeral Service, Oakvale.
